The sequence with oxazole 73 also proves to be applicable to systems in which the double bond of the allylic alcohol fragment is incorporated into a heteroaromatic ring, such as in furfuryl alcohol (77a) and thiophene-2-methanol (77b).28 After hydrolysis of the oxazolone ring with water, V-benzoyl-3,3,3-trifluoro-2-(2-methyl-3-furyl)alanine (79a) and /V-benzoyl-3,3,3-trifluoro-2-(2-melhyl-3-thienyl)alanine (79b) are obtained. The 2-methylene helerocyclcs 78 originally formed in the Claisen rearrangement undergo rearomatizalion under the reaction conditions. [Pg.212]

The eighth volume of this serial publication comprises eight contributions from international authors. Four of these deal with well-defined groups of compounds thiopyrones (R. Zahradnik, R. Mayer, and W. Broy), phenoxazines and phenothiazines (M. Ionescu and H. Mantsch), diazepines (F. D. Popp and A. Catala Noble), and benz-isoxazoles (anthranils and indoxazenes) (K.-H. Wiinsch and A. J. Boulton). J. M. Tedder has surveyed the field of the heteroaromatic diazo compounds which are derived from a variety of heterocyclic ring systems, and M. Schulz and K. Kirschke discuss heterocyclic peroxides. The remaining two chapters survey well-known reactions the Hilbert-Johnson reaction is covered by J. Pliml and M. PrystaS, and heterocyclic Claisen rearrangements by B. S. Thyagarajan. [Pg.424]
